The Importance of Sustainable Building Materials

Defining sustainability in construction is a crucial step towards creating a healthier and more environmentally conscious home. A sustainable building material supports environmental health, human well-being, and long-term resource efficiency. Look for materials that come from responsible sources, are safe for indoor air quality, and are made with minimal waste. By choosing sustainable building materials, you'll not only reduce your environmental impact but also increase the property value of your apartment.
- Recycled Materials: Incorporate recycled materials into your renovation, such as reclaimed wood, recycled glass, and salvaged metal. These materials not only reduce waste but also add a touch of character to your space.
- Bamboo: Bamboo is a highly renewable and sustainable building material that can be used for flooring, walls, and ceilings.
- Sheep's Wool: Sheep's wool is a natural insulator that can help reduce energy consumption and create a healthier indoor environment.
- Cork: Cork is a durable and eco-friendly flooring option that can provide excellent insulation and soundproofing.
- Low-Flow Fixtures: Install low-flow fixtures, such as toilets and showerheads, to reduce water consumption and minimize your water footprint.
- Mushroom-Based Materials: Mushroom-based materials, such as mycelium, can be used to create sustainable insulation and even walls.

Benefits of Green Building Materials
- Reduced Carbon Emissions: By incorporating sustainable building materials, you can reduce your carbon footprint and contribute to a more eco-friendly environment.
- Increased Property Value: Sustainable building materials can increase the value of your apartment and appeal to environmentally conscious occupants.
- Improved Indoor Air Quality: Eco-friendly materials can help reduce indoor air pollutants and create a healthier living space.
- Saved Energy: Sustainable building materials can help reduce energy consumption and save you money on your utility bills.
- Unique Aesthetic: Green building materials can add a touch of character and uniqueness to your space, making it stand out from other apartments.
